Validates one or more fmri_jobs against the structural contract their template implies, collecting issues per job. Intended to run on the driver before run_jobs() / export_jobs().

Usage

preflight(x, check_files = FALSE, on_issue = c("warn", "error", "collect"))

Arguments

x

A single fmri_job or a list of them.

check_files

Logical; for file-backed jobs, verify scan paths exist.

on_issue

One of "warn" (default), "error" (stop if any issue), or "collect" (return silently).

Value

Invisibly, an object of class fmri_preflight with an $issues data frame (job_id, message) and $ok.

Details

Checks performed per job: template validity; every variable referenced by the design formula and block is a column of that job's event table; TR is positive; run lengths are consistent with the data (matrix_dataset: rows match sum(run_length); fmri_dataset: one run_length per scan file); nuisance regressor rows match the total number of scans; and, when check_files = TRUE, that file-backed scans exist on disk.

The design-column check uses all.vars() on the formula, so it is deliberately conservative: a formula with a variable-valued HRF argument (e.g. hrf(x, basis = my_basis)) may flag my_basis as a missing column. Event tables supplied as file paths are not yet validated here.

Examples

tmpl <- fmri_template(onset ~ hrf(condition), ~ run)
job <- instantiate(tmpl, list(id = "sub-01",
                              scans = matrix(rnorm(80 * 2), 80, 2), TR = 2,
                              run_length = c(40, 40),
                              events = data.frame(onset = c(5, 45),
                                                  condition = factor(c("A", "B")),
                                                  run = c(1, 2))))
preflight(job)
